E.8 Braking system
E.8.1 Braking component selection
When the VFD driving a high-inertia load decelerates or needs to decelerate abruptly, the motor runs in the power
generation state and transmits the load-carrying energy to the DC circuit of the VFD, causing the bus voltage of the VFD
to rise. If the bus voltage exceeds a specific value, the VFD reports an overvoltage fault. To prevent this from happening,
you need to configure braking components.

E.8.2 Braking unit
The 45kW rectifier unit model is equipped with the built-in braking unit, and other rectifier unit models can be configured
only with external braking units. Select braking resistors according to the specific requirements (such as the braking
torque and braking usage) on site.

Note:
Select braking resistors according to the resistance and power data provided by our company.
The braking resistor may increase the braking torque of the VFD. The preceding table describes the resistance and
power for 100% braking torque, 10% braking usage, 50% braking usage, and 80% braking usage. You can select the
braking system based on the actual operation conditions.
When using an external braking unit, set the brake voltage class of the braking unit properly by referring to the
manual of the dynamic braking unit. If the voltage class is set incorrectly, the VFD may not run properly.
